We have quite the extensive collection in our nerd closet, but it’s nice to play a game of Dominos or cards with friends, without having to read through a 20 page rule book first. Someone needs to tell Dan that he can’t take 5 mins each turn, and that games are only social when they move easily. This is why I rely on the classics when breaking-in a new gang of friends.
